What does a Computer Network Support Specialist do?
A Computer Network Support Specialist performs various tasks on a daily basis. Here are the core responsibilities you can expect in this role:
- Back up network data.
- Configure security settings or access permissions for groups or individuals.
- Analyze and report computer network security breaches or attempted breaches.
- Identify the causes of networking problems, using diagnostic testing software and equipment.
- Document network support activities.

How to use AI to improve your Computer Network Support Specialist resume
AI tools like ChatGPT can be incredibly helpful when crafting your Computer Network Support Specialist resume. They can help you brainstorm achievements, rephrase bullet points for impact, identify missing keywords, and tailor your content to specific job descriptions.
However, AI is not perfect. Always proofread the output carefully. AI can sometimes make factual errors, use generic language, or miss the nuances of your specific experience. Think of AI as a helpful assistant, not a replacement for your own judgment.
